Human sciences is the combination of those sciences and disciplines that relate to typically human activity.
Basicly, Human sciences encompass social sciences and humanities, including art.
Usually Human sciences are also understood to have extentions towards those applied sciences that pre-suppose a high degree of human interaction, like economics, architecture, etc...
Human sciences are usually not seen as a separate academic discipline, although:
- Sometimes Human sciences are considered, more or less loosely, as a synonym to humanities;
- In other contexts Human sciences are treated as a subdivision of e.g. philosophy or literature.
However, the present category considers primarily the interdisciplinary aspect of Human sciences, as e.g. in socio-cultural anthropology
